Subject: [PATCH net 5/8] netlink: specs: rt-link: add an attr layer around alt-ifname

alt-ifname attr is directly placed in requests (as an alternative
to ifname) but in responses its wrapped up in IFLA_PROP_LIST
and only there is may be multi-attr. See rtnl_fill_prop_list().

Fixes: b2f63d904e72 ("doc/netlink: Add spec for rt link messages")
Signed-off-by: Jakub Kicinski <kuba@kernel.org>
---
 Documentation/netlink/specs/rt_link.yaml | 11 ++++++++---
 1 file changed, 8 insertions(+), 3 deletions(-)

diff --git a/Documentation/netlink/specs/rt_link.yaml b/Documentation/netlink/specs/rt_link.yaml
index 31238455f8e9..200e9a7e5b11 100644
--- a/Documentation/netlink/specs/rt_link.yaml
+++ b/Documentation/netlink/specs/rt_link.yaml
@@ -1113,11 +1113,10 @@ protonum: 0
       -
         name: prop-list
         type: nest
-        nested-attributes: link-attrs
+        nested-attributes: prop-list-link-attrs
       -
         name: alt-ifname
         type: string
-        multi-attr: true
       -
         name: perm-address
         type: binary
@@ -1163,6 +1162,13 @@ protonum: 0
       -
         name: netns-immutable
         type: u8
+  -
+    name: prop-list-link-attrs
+    subset-of: link-attrs
+    attributes:
+      -
+        name: alt-ifname
+        multi-attr: true
   -
     name: af-spec-attrs
     attributes:
@@ -2453,7 +2459,6 @@ protonum: 0
             - min-mtu
             - max-mtu
             - prop-list
-            - alt-ifname
             - perm-address
             - proto-down-reason
             - parent-dev-name
